Handwriting Calculator is a showcase of Nokia’s new handwriting recognition technology. It allows you to calculate handwritten math expressions with a touch-screen Nokia device (and with a Windows PC). The Nokia Handwriting Calculator is a Calculator for the Nokia 5800 XpressMusic, N810 and N800

Calcium for S60 3rd Edition - Using some of the concepts that make ControlFreak so easy to use, the authors removed the need to select on-screen buttons and moved all the operations to the joystick. Doing basic calculations on your phone is now only a couple of clicks away.
